**About the Role**

The role of a Casual Support Worker at Advance is as varied as the customers we work with.

You could find yourself supporting someone to carry out day to day tasks like, administering Medication, budgeting, shopping, cooking, personal care, cleaning and accompanying customers to appointments.

You could just as easily be helping someone to realise their ambitions to go to college, develop their art or music skills, get a job, or go out clubbing

What is certain is that you’ll get all training and support you will need to get to know your customers and develop the skills and confidence you need to carry out your role effectively.

It’s a great place to progress too: lots of our Casual Support Workers have gone on to be managers, and some have moved into permanent roles in other areas of our business.

Once you’re with us, there are genuine opportunities to learn, develop and build a long and rewarding career.

Equally, there is the chance to work flexibly, fitting your role around your other life commitments.

**About Advance**

Advance is a national provider of housing and support to people with learning disabilities and mental health conditions. Our vision is to transform lives; providing the best quality housing and support services so that people can live the lives they choose, achieve their personal goals, feel valued and know their voices are heard.
